VEGN Summary
The US Vegan Climate ETF (VEGN) follows the Beyond Investing US Vegan Climate Index, focusing on U.S. companies that avoid harming animals and aim to reduce environmental damage. Although its theme is vegan and climate-friendly, most of its holdings are large technology and financial firms, not farms or food producers. Well-known companies in the fund include Apple and Nvidia. Someone might invest in VEGN to seek growth from major U.S. stocks while aligning their money with ethical and environmental values. A key risk is that it is heavily tilted toward tech stocks, so its price can rise and fall sharply with that sector.
How much will it cost me?The US Vegan Climate ETF (VEGN) has an expense ratio of 0.6%, which means you’ll pay $6 per year for every $1,000 invested. This is higher than average for ETFs because it is actively managed to align with ethical and sustainable investment principles, requiring more specialized research and oversight.

VEGN Top 10 Holdings
VEGN may wear a vegan and climate-friendly label, but under the hood it’s powered by U.S. Big Tech and chipmakers. Micron, Nvidia, AMD, and Lam Research are the main engines, with chip stocks generally rising and giving the fund a strong AI-flavored tailwind. Apple and Broadcom look a bit more mixed lately, occasionally losing steam and tempering gains. Visa and Mastercard add a steady payments theme, but overall this is a U.S.-centric, tech-heavy story where semiconductor swings do most of the driving.
